The Port of Tacoma is seeking qualified partners to deliver workforce development services supporting the maritime, logistics, manufacturing, and construction trades. - Government Buyer: Port of Tacoma (POT) - No specific OEMs or commercial vendors are named in this solicitation - Services requested: - Occupational job training and placement - Job advancement and retention support - Pre-apprenticeship training - Occupational education and internship programs - All services focused on maritime, logistics, manufacturing, and construction sectors - Notable requirements: - Providers must demonstrate experience in recruiting, training, and placing individuals in the specified trades - Strong relationships with employers and stakeholders are required - Deliverables include detailed annual and semi-annual reports on program outcomes, and bi-monthly updates to the contract manager - Proposals should be scalable and compensation information must be submitted separately - Open to both individual providers and teams; MWBE participation is encouraged but not required - Contract details: - Initial term of one year, with options to renew for up to three years total - Annual contract value not to exceed $260,000
Description
The Port of Tacoma is soliciting proposals for providing occupational job training and placement, job advancement and retention, pre-apprenticeship training, or occupational education programs related to maritime, logistics, manufacturing, and construction trades. The contract period is one year with options for renewal up to three years. The total contract value will not exceed $260,000 per year. The Port anticipates awarding one or more contracts and requires detailed reporting and communication from the service providers.
